+ <ul>
+ <li><em>HTTP logs on the Jalview website</em><br> We record
+ IP addresses of machines which access the web site, either via the
+ browser when downloading the application, or when the Jalview Desktop
+ user interface is launched.<br> <br>
+ <ul>
+ <li><i>The Jalview Getdown Launcher</i> (Since 2.11.0) examines
+ release channels every time Jalview launches to determine if a new
+ release is available.</li>
+ <li><i>The questionnaire web service at
+ www.jalview.org/cgi-bin/questionnaire.pl is checked and a unique
+ cookie for the current questionnaire is stored in the Jalview
+ properties file.</i></li>
+ <li><i>The Jalview web services stack is contacted to
+ retrieve the currently available web services. All interactions
+ with the public Jalview web services are logged, but we delete all
+ job data (input data and results) after about two weeks.</i></li>
+ </ul> <br></li>
+ <li><em>Usage Analytics</em><br> Since Jalview 2.11.2.7, the
+ Jalview Desktop records usage data with a self-hosted instance of the
+ analytics stack <a href="https://plausible.io">Plausible.io</a> via a
+ custom GPLv3 client developed by Ben Soares. Prior to this, Jalview
+ versions as far back as 2.4 recorded application launches via <a
+ href="http://code.google.com/p/jgoogleanalytics/">JGoogleAnalytics</a>
+ .<br> Usage logs for Jalview record the fact that the
+ application was started, and details about the OS, installed Jalview
+ launcher (if any) and java version used. In the future, we will use
+ this mechanism to improve the Desktop user interface, by tracking
+ which parts of the user interface are being used most often.</li>
+ </ul>
